Details of Weekly DPS
- Deposit Amount: Tk. 250/500/1,000/2,000/5,000 per week
- Term: 6 months or 12 months
- Charge-free Cash Out with profit after maturity
- AIT and Excise Duty will be applicable
Learn how to start a DPS from the bKash App
- Tap on Savings from bKash App home screen
- Tap Open New Savings from the Savings Dashboard
- Select “DPS” from Savings Type
- Select your purpose
- Select 6 months or 12 months as Tenure
- Select Weekly as DPS Type
- Select Deposit Amount (Tk. 250/500/1,000/2,000/5,000 weekly) and tap Proceed
- Select your preferred scheme of the list of Financial Institutions and Banks and see the total deposit amount
- Enter Nominee-related information and tap Proceed
- After reviewing Savings Summary, tap Confirm
- Tap Accept after reviewing Scheme Terms & Conditions
- Enter your PIN on the PIN Screen
- Tap and hold to start DPS
- You will get a confirmation from both banks/financial institutions and bKash on the next screen if the request submission is successful
Now you have successfully opened your Weekly DPS. Keep sufficient balance in your bKash Account on the specific day of every week. After the full term of your savings, the total deposit with profit will be disbursed in your bKash Account and Cash Out without any charge!
You must know the followings related to DPS
- You can open multiple DPS from your bKash App
- You can change the nominee information if needed
- There is no hidden/additional charge for DOS from bKash/Institutes
- Upon completing a DPS to maturity and having DPS maturity amount disbursed into the bKash user’s account, if the bKash user fully or partially cashes out the DPS maturity amount the corresponding Cash Out fee borne by the user will be offset by bKash.
- DPS cannot be cancelled before completion of 3 months. However, you can request for early encashment any time after completing 3 months
- bKash shall not be responsible if anyone using your PIN, Verification Code and other information fraudulently cancels the DPS facility through this platform
- If you want to close your DPS before the maturity date, you may not receive the full interest as per your chosen DPS. For more information, related to forgone interest income and other charges (if any) please see Bank/FI’s T&C
- If you do not have sufficient fund in your bKash Account or your account is not in active status at the time of attempted debit transaction, the transaction will fail and bKash will retry to debit your account on the following three consecutive days. If the debit transaction fails due to insufficient balance or account status, you may not be entitled to potential interest earnings from the DPS Provider Bank/FI for that specific day. If the debit transaction fails at the last attempt it will be considered as a missed instalment and you will not be entitled to potential interest earnings from the DPS Provider/Bank/FI related to the relevant deposit amount
- The interest rate on DPS shall be determined solely by Bank/FI
